Why Replace Your Tacoma’s Spark Plugs?

Your Tacoma’s spark plugs are the unsung heroes of combustion. These small components create the spark that ignites the air-fuel mixture in your engine’s cylinders. When they’re worn, your truck’s performance suffers.

Signs you need new spark plugs include:

  • Rough idling or misfiring
  • Decreased fuel economy
  • Sluggish acceleration
  • Hard starting
  • Engine hesitation

Replacing spark plugs at the right interval isn’t just about fixing problems—it’s about preventing them and maintaining optimal performance.

When to Replace Toyota Tacoma Spark Plugs

Knowing the right replacement interval for your Tacoma’s spark plugs depends on your specific engine:

2.7L 4-Cylinder (2TR-FE) Engine

If you’re running standard copper plugs, plan on replacement every 30,000 miles. Upgraded to platinum or iridium plugs? You can extend that to 60,000-100,000 miles depending on the specific plug material.

3.5L V6 (2GR-FKS) Engine

For the V6 Tacoma, Toyota recommends replacement every 60,000 miles when using OEM iridium plugs like the Denso FK20HBR8.

Remember that harsh driving conditions—like frequent towing, off-roading, or stop-and-go traffic—might require more frequent replacement.

Tools and Parts You’ll Need

Before starting, gather these essential tools and parts:

Essential Tools

  • Spark plug socket (5/8″ for V6, 16mm for I4)
  • Torque wrench (capable of 10-20 ft-lb)
  • Socket extensions (various lengths)
  • Ratchet and swivel adapter
  • 10mm and 12mm sockets
  • Flathead screwdriver and pick tool

Required Parts

Engine Type Recommended Spark Plug Gap Specification Torque Specification
2.7L I4 (2TR-FE) NGK or Denso 0.044″ (1.1mm) 13 ft-lb (18 Nm)
3.5L V6 (2GR-FKS) Denso FK20HBR8 0.028-0.031″ (0.7-0.8mm) 13 ft-lb (18 Nm)

Optional Supplies

  • Anti-seize compound (if plugs don’t include plating)
  • Dielectric grease for coil boots
  • Shop towels
  • Compressed air (to blow debris from plug wells)

Preparing for Spark Plug Replacement

Take these important preparation steps before starting:

  1. Make sure your engine is completely cool. Working on a hot engine risks burns and can make removing parts difficult.
  2. Park on a level surface with plenty of working room.
  3. Disconnect the negative battery terminal to prevent electrical shorts.
  4. Have your service manual or this guide handy for reference.

Step-by-Step Toyota Tacoma Spark Plug Replacement

Let’s break down the spark plug replacement process for both engine types:

Accessing the Spark Plugs

For Both 2.7L I4 and 3.5L V6 (Passenger Side)

  1. Remove the engine cover by unscrewing the two 10mm nuts.
  2. Detach the intake resonator and air inlet tube by loosening the clamps and unclipping any attached wiring harness.

For 3.5L V6 Only (Driver’s Side)

  1. Remove small brackets and/or support bars (10-12mm bolts) to gain access.
  2. Carefully unclip vacuum hoses and the ambient-air sensor as needed.

The V6 engine has three plugs on each side of the engine, while the 4-cylinder has all four plugs accessible from the top.

Removing the Ignition Coils

For each spark plug, you’ll need to:

  1. Locate the ignition coil connected to the spark plug.
  2. Disconnect the electrical connector by depressing the locking tab and pulling straight back.
  3. Remove the 10mm bolt securing the coil to the engine.
  4. Pull the coil straight up and out, being careful to keep it aligned with the plug to avoid damaging the boot.

Pro tip: Work on one spark plug at a time to avoid mixing up the firing order.

Removing the Old Spark Plugs

  1. Insert your spark plug socket with appropriate extension onto the plug.
  2. Turn counterclockwise to loosen and remove the old plug.
  3. Inspect the old plug for signs of engine problems:
    • Tan/light gray deposits indicate good combustion
    • Black sooty deposits suggest a rich fuel mixture
    • White/blistered electrodes might indicate overheating
    • Oil fouling could signal more serious engine issues

Installing New Spark Plugs

  1. Check the gap on your new plugs using a gap tool. For the 2.7L engine, the gap should be 0.044″ (1.1mm). For the 3.5L V6, aim for 0.028-0.031″ (0.7-0.8mm).
  2. If needed, carefully adjust the gap by bending the ground electrode slightly (be extremely careful with iridium or platinum plugs).
  3. Thread the new plug in by hand first to avoid cross-threading.
  4. Once hand-tight, use your torque wrench to tighten to the specified torque—typically 13 ft-lb (18 Nm) for both Tacoma engines.

Reinstalling the Ignition Coils

  1. Apply a small amount of dielectric grease to the inside of each coil boot.
  2. Align the coil with the spark plug and press down firmly until seated.
  3. Reinstall the 10mm bolt and torque to approximately 7-10 in-lb (about 0.8-1.1 Nm) for the V6.
  4. Reconnect the electrical connector until you hear it click.

Reassembling Everything

  1. Reinstall all intake components, brackets, and hoses in reverse order of removal.
  2. Double-check that all electrical connections are secure.
  3. Reconnect the negative battery terminal.

Dealing with Challenging Spark Plugs

The 3.5L V6 Tacoma can present some challenges, particularly with the driver’s side plugs. Here are some tips:

For Hard-to-Reach Plugs

  • Use a universal joint adapter with your socket extensions for better angles.
  • Try different length extensions to find the optimal reach.
  • Take your time—rushing often leads to dropped parts or damaged components.

For Stuck or Seized Plugs

  • Apply penetrating oil where the plug meets the head and let sit for 15-30 minutes.
  • Gently work the plug back and forth to break corrosion.
  • Never force a plug—excessive force can damage cylinder head threads.

Post-Replacement Checks

After completing your Toyota Tacoma spark plug replacement:

  1. Start the engine and listen for any unusual noises.
  2. Check for any warning lights on your dashboard.
  3. Take a short test drive to ensure the engine runs smoothly under various conditions.
  4. If you notice misfires or rough running, check your connections.

Optimizing Performance with the Right Plugs

Choosing the right spark plugs for your Tacoma can make a significant difference:

Standard Copper Plugs

  • Most affordable option
  • Excellent conductivity
  • Shorter lifespan (typically 30,000 miles)
  • Good for older Tacomas or budget-conscious owners

Platinum Plugs

  • Middle-range price point
  • Longer lifespan than copper (60,000+ miles)
  • Good all-around performance
  • Excellent for daily drivers

Iridium Plugs

  • Most expensive option
  • Longest lifespan (80,000-100,000 miles)
  • Best performance and fuel economy
  • Recommended for newer Tacomas

For the 3.5L V6, many owners report best results using the exact OEM Denso FK20HBR8 iridium plugs, which provide optimal performance and longevity.

Common Mistakes to Avoid

Save yourself time and headaches by avoiding these common mistakes:

Improper Gap Setting

Taking time to properly gap your plugs is crucial. Even pre-gapped plugs should be verified before installation. Incorrect gaps can cause misfires, poor performance, and even damage to ignition components.

Over-Torquing Plugs

Using too much force when installing spark plugs can strip threads in the cylinder head—an expensive repair. Always use a torque wrench set to the manufacturer’s specifications.

Damaged Coil Boots

Carefully inspect the rubber boots on your ignition coils before reinstalling. Cracked or damaged boots can cause spark to leak, resulting in misfires. If you find damage, replace the coil.

Mismatched Plug Heat Range

Always use plugs with the correct heat range for your specific Tacoma. Using the wrong heat range can lead to pre-ignition, detonation, or fouling.

Cost Savings of DIY Spark Plug Replacement

Replacing spark plugs yourself can save significant money:

Service DIY Cost Shop Cost Savings
4-cylinder $30-60 for plugs $150-250 $90-220
V6 $60-120 for plugs $250-400 $130-340

Beyond the immediate savings, properly maintained spark plugs improve fuel economy and prevent more costly repairs down the road.

Maintaining Your Spark Plugs Between Replacements

To maximize the life of your new spark plugs:

  1. Use high-quality fuel from reputable stations.
  2. Change your air filter regularly—dirty air affects combustion.
  3. Address check engine lights promptly, especially those related to misfires.
  4. Follow your Tacoma’s maintenance schedule for oil changes and other services.
  5. Consider fuel system cleaners every 10,000 miles to keep injectors clean.
